Health Risks of Caffeine Overconsumption
- Jitters, anxiety, and insomnia can occur due to high caffeine intake.
 - Caffeine can interact with certain medications and worsen underlying health conditions.
 - Excessive caffeine consumption can lead to dehydration, particularly in people who are sensitive to its diuretic effects.
